99/93 added to 81/3 in Fraction Form

The result of 99/93 added to 81/3 is: 28 2/31

Step-by-Step Solution

Step 1: Understand the Problem

Step 2: Find the Least Common Multiple (LCM)

To add fractions, we need a common denominator. The LCM of 93 and 3 is 93.

Step 3: Convert Fractions to Equivalent Fractions

Step 4: Add the Numerators

Add the numerators: 99 + 2511 = 2610

Step 5: Simplify the Fraction

The greatest common divisor (GCD) of 2610 and 93 is 3.

Understanding Fraction Addition

How to Add Fractions

To add fractions, you need to ensure they have a common denominator. Then add the numerators:

Why Simplify Fractions?

Simplifying fractions makes them easier to work with and understand. A fraction is in its simplest form when the numerator and denominator have no common factors other than 1.

To simplify a fraction, divide both the numerator and denominator by their greatest common divisor (GCD).
